Product Description

Fully illustrated guide to therapeutic flowers & their uses, & how to make safe, effective treatments at home. It

Includes::
easy-to-prepare remedies to treat everyday ailments ranging from nausea & PMS to insomnia & sore throats.

All over the world, throughout time, people have found ways to harness the natural healing powers of flowers. This book gives guidance on the harvesting & preparation of flowers, & introduces the reader to their variety of uses, such as tisanes, tinctures & infused oils, as well as flower essences & essential oils.

Specific treatments are recommended for everyday complaints such as stress, anxiety, painful periods, headaches, depression, skin problems & insomnia.

It offers more than 160 photographs that include useful step-by-step sequences that demonstrate how to make flower teas, tinctures & infused oils.
